3D model description

So, for long time I wanted to make a modular system for x-carriage. To be able to swap hotends, extruders, to attach laser, pen or a dremel tool fairly easily. I came up with this design. It's still work in progress. But the E3D setup works fine.

The extruder part is based on https://www.thingiverse.com/thing:2469435 . So any addons should fit.

The backplate is designed to take brass 3mm m3 threaded inserts to mount stuff:
https://www.aliexpress.com/item/100PCS-M3-3-4-MM-Brass-Inserts-Double-Pass-Copper-Knurl-Nut-Embedded-Fastener/32825235531.html

All of modules are screwed using machine m3 (mainly 10mm) bolts.

The x-tensioner also fits standard MK8 extruder setup from ANET A8.

Next step is to add connector to make electronics modular but I still have some thinking to do before publishing anything.

*** UPDATE 01 - 23.10.17 ***
Fan Holder - increased clearance (6mm) between the radial fan and backplate to better accommodate "Mistral 2.1a" fan duct: https://www.thingiverse.com/thing:2121279

*** UPDATE 02 - 27.10.17 ***
Dial indicator - added. For accurate bed levelling.

*** UPDATE 03 - 29.12.17 ***
+ BLV Mod update: https://www.thingiverse.com/thing:2567757
I added the backplate mount for the BLV Mod. It's a simple design to be mounted on single MGN12H block. Belt clamp integrated.

  • titan extruder mount added. To make it work with the mistral fan an extender was added.

  • Electronics decoupler added. Standard gold-pin in 2,54 raster PCB. The PCB dimensions: 30x20,5 mm. Ale screwed together using M2 bolt.

details in renders and pictures.

*** UPDATE 04 - 23.02.18 ***
+ added 3DTouch/BLTouch mount. Settings I used:
X_PROBE_OFFSET_FROM_EXTRUDER 38

Y_PROBE_OFFSET_FROM_EXTRUDER 0

Z_PROBE_OFFSET_FROM_EXTRUDER -0.90

I would reccomend calibrating z offset yourself because it might be a little different.

  • filament guide added.

*** UPDATE 05 - 21.03.18 ***
+ added 3DTouch/BLTouch mount integrated with Titan mount. Two M3 3mm brass inserts and two 6mm bolts are needed to mount the 3DTouch. This part is experimental! Not printed and not tested by me. I never got to use Titan that much. My mk8 extruder works just fine.

  • added picture comparison of 3D Benchy printed on Original Prusa i3 MK3 and my BLV. .15 layer hight, Devil Design Navy Blue PLA. Mine on the left :)

*** UPDATE 06 - 19.08.18 ***
+ Added Titan AERO mount (adapter - mount is the same as for standard Titan) and Titan Aero fan shroud (ninja fan).

*** UPDATE 07 - 06.12.18 ***
+ Added backplate dxf

*** UPDATE 08 - 15.01.19 ***
+ Released source files. Both step and fusion archive available. Released as-is. Have fun :)
